Output ecfe669631f4bda63e3aaee049657dc906ebc4f858919c586d020b1ffb328cd0:2

value
44606
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7e283664247a77334fffeae43f86d54ebaf7accf81783ab91f98b848642e27ae
address
bc1p0c5rvepy0fmnxnllatjrlpk4f6a00tx0s9ur4wglnzuysepwy7hqje89r6
transaction
ecfe669631f4bda63e3aaee049657dc906ebc4f858919c586d020b1ffb328cd0
confirmations
77640
spent
true